Water towers get crammed by pumping water from a water treatment plant or other sources into the tower. The water flows by way of an inlet pipe and fills the tank, making a reservoir of water that can be distributed to buildings and businesses. Rather, the principle operate of a water tower is to pressurize water for distribution to nearby residents. First, the water is pumped up into the tower from the water source into the reservoir. Next, gravity forces the water down, creating pressure that pushes water via the local system. There are lots of factors that decide the prices of a water tower. Water towers are a powerful feat of engineering and are common across the US. Private landowners can function a small tower to supply water to their homes, and bigger cities rely on large water towers that may maintain tens of millions of gallons. Every foot of vertical elevation supplies roughly zero.forty three kilos of pressure per sq. inch. So your tower needs to be as excessive as stress requirements on any connected water system.
